返回

文章详情

可销售软件的最小可行单位

Hacker News2026年6月21日 16:41

上周,我写了关于离开Stainless的事情,以及我打算将我的副项目River发展成一个小型可持续业务的计划。当我发送那封信时,有几个人询问我在这个人工智能时代经营软件公司的思考过程:“你疯了吗?!你发布的任何东西都可能被一个LLM构建的内部包瞬间取代!”我现在已经成为LLM的支持者之一,我承认这是一个非常合理的问题。确实,我可能疯了,但我会讲述我的思考过程,你可以自己判断。让我先讲一个轶事。今天早上,我在互联网上一个最糟糕的参与者农场和虚假信息和虚构轶事的超级推销者聚集地LinkedIn上闲逛。其中一个用户发布了一条关于他公司每月在Atlassian的Jira上花费400美元的帖子。他对此离谱的账单感到个人受到了轻视,于是他让他的团队使用Claude构建了一个新的内部任务跟踪器。Jira和每月400美元的开支消失了,取而代之的是一个可根据他们的需求进行工具化的自定义包,通过LLM的持续优化来实现。多年来,我们一直在软件界讨论购置与构建的问题,但去年情况发生了变化。过去,构建是一个非常昂贵的提议,尤其是在工程师薪资和优秀人才稀缺的情况下。人们可以预计巨大的前期成本、时间表超支以及无尽的复杂问题。一般的智慧一直是仅在核心领域内部构建,避免被外围项目分散精力。一旦你的公司达到巨大的规模,而这些干扰的成本恰如其分地消失在利润中,也许这些项目才值得去做。但LLM改变了这一切。突然之间,通过让模型 القيام工作,生产出实质性的软件变得相当可行。便宜不等于零。虽然LLM使得构建软件的成本显著降低,但并没有使其为零。良好的LLM构建的系统仍然涉及一个反馈循环,操作员需要让模型工作一段时间,根据结果进行调整,请求另一轮,再进一步优化,等等,通常需要数十个循环才能得到一个在所花费时间和质量之间的最佳妥协的令人满意的结果。而且像以前一样,维护将是一项持续的费用。尤其是对于更加复杂的包,总有功能需要添加或错误需要修复。LLM会使这些更改更容易进行,但并没有让它们变得免费,最昂贵的部分是看管和验证结果的人工劳动。回到我们上面提到的400美元/月的Atlassian轶事:在考虑了初始构建努力,包括优化过程,以及持续的LLM驱动维护后,这是否通过了“嗅觉测试”?一个任务跟踪器仍然是一种复杂的软件,即便大量使用LLM,人们也应期望初步推进至少花费几周时间(这是宽容的)。从那里,内部负责人将转为处理错误和功能开发。让我们试着提出一些粗略的数字来量化情况。假设我们有一位年薪20万美元的工程师,每周工作40小时(暂时假设9/9/6从未被设想)。那就是每月1.67万美元,每周3850美元,或者每小时96美元:薪水=200_000.0 {月:薪水 / 12,周:薪水 / 52,小时:薪水 / 52 / 40,}.each { |k, v| puts “%-6s $%0.2f” % [“#{k}:” , v] } 月:$16666.67 周:$3846.15 小时:$96.15 为了抵消本应支付给Atlassian的每月400美元,工程师每月最多只能花4小时(400 / 96)在他们自制的Jira克隆上进行功能/修复的提示,或者照看其数据库,或者其他事情,不包括上下文切换的开销。即便有LLM的帮助,这完全不现实,但我们还是宽容地说他们能将其缩减到每月2小时。即便如此,在那两周的初始努力之后,还需要37个月才能达到收支平衡(收回Atlassian的每月400美元减去每月2小时维护工作的时间=2 * 3846.15 / (400 - 2 * 96.15))。别误会我的意思,我和使用过Jira的任何人一样讨厌它,并且有着几乎无法控制的冲动想要重建它,但这里的数学是不成立的。构建门槛。但这是否总是成立?让我们从另一个方面来看,一个价格更高的SaaS产品。Gemini报告说,完全配置的Salesforce座位的价格大约是每月500美元。假设你需要50个座位,那就是每月2.5万美元!以这个价格,你可以让1.5倍的工程资源(25 / 16.7)全职投入到你的克隆开发中。同样,CRM是一款相对复杂的软件,重建并不简单,但无论你怎么解释,对于一个较小的公司来说,这更接近于一个“构建”的决定。(而且Salesforce今年迄今已下跌30%,市场似乎也相信这一点。)我主张(和/或希望)...

赞助内容

NordVPN Next-gen Antivirus

本站免费、广告极少。如果觉得有帮助,可以请我们喝杯咖啡 —— 任何金额都对持续运营有实际帮助。

请我喝杯咖啡